Output efc5fe8428e0bd658fa67f6ae35e36ad10851ee53c538efe070f7ff430262092:6
- value
- 20638566
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5fd596d02553172c2a2d3f4bead333aaa817949
- address
- bc1qkh74jmgz25ch9s4z606tatfn824gz72ff8ehnh
- transaction
- efc5fe8428e0bd658fa67f6ae35e36ad10851ee53c538efe070f7ff430262092
- spent
- false